    I have a Sharp TM150 and the internet and IM&#39;ing on it have come in handy but it all kills the battery in a short period of time. Also, it&#39;s not the easiest thing to hold up multiple conversations at once on IM. Phone can&#39;t load some pages and this site, specifically, takes a long long time to load and can&#39;t always load all the content. T-Mobile also likes to be a pain and not work for periods of time.

    However, if you use it while plugged into the charger, you can eliminate the battery dying quickly con.

    Anyhow, that&#39;s just what I&#39;ve found with my phone&#39;s web browser and wanted to lay that all out for you before you decide to get it or not.
